Transaction 002967fdfa3cd8a1f8bd410620155cf08ea5da4f50da35de46ab4c8622eb6888
1 Input
1 Output
-
002967fdfa3cd8a1f8bd410620155cf08ea5da4f50da35de46ab4c8622eb6888:0
- value
- 345633
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d84437cf9b837aa29e6cd208dfe0161add3fe7a7 OP_EQUAL
- address
- 3MQXbrEXXJ4fdo1kKWLFCAQXRddVKSmqED